Oceanic crust is composed of magma that erupts on the seafloor to create basalt lava flows or cools deeper down to create the intrusive igneous rock gabbro. Mantle is sandwiched between the crust and the outer core. The mantle is about 2,900 kilometers. The mantle lies between earth’s dense, superheated core and its thin outer layer, the crust. The mantle, a thick layer extending to a depth of 2,890 km, is composed of solid silicates and can be divided into the upper and lower mantle, with a transition zone in between.
